Title: Replacing Bifold Doors: A Comprehensive Guide

Bifold doors have been a popular choice for house owners for several years due to their space-saving style and visual appeal. However, like any other home component, bifold doors can become worn or harmed in time, necessitating replacement. This article will supply a detailed guide on how to replace bifold doors, consisting of the actions involved, tools required, and often asked questions.

Changing bifold doors is a reasonably straightforward procedure that can be finished in a few hours with the right tools and understanding. The first action is to get rid of the old doors. This includes unlocking the doors and raising them off their tracks. As soon as the old doors are removed, the track system can be unscrewed from the door frame and removed.

The next step is to install the new door frame. This involves measuring the width and height of the door frame and cutting the new frame to size. The frame must then be screwed into place, guaranteeing it is level and plumb. Once the frame is installed, the brand-new track system can be attached.

The final action is to install the new bifold doors. This includes hanging the doors on the track system and adjusting them to guarantee they open and close efficiently. It is important to guarantee the doors are appropriately aligned and balanced to prevent damage to the track system or the doors themselves.

Tools needed for replacing bifold doors include a screwdriver, hammer, determining tape, level, saw, and drill. It is likewise advised to have an assistant to assist with lifting and holding the doors in place.

Frequently asked questions:

  1. Can I replace bifold doors myself, or do I need to employ a professional?While it is possible to replace bifold doors yourself, it might be advantageous to employ a professional if you are not comfortable with the process or do not have the needed tools.
  2. The length of time does it take to replace bifold doors?Replacing bifold doors can take anywhere from a few hours to a full day, depending on the intricacy of the setup and the number of doors being replaced.
  3. Can I recycle the old track system when setting up brand-new bifold doors?It is not recommended to recycle the old track system as it may be worn or harmed, which can affect the operation of the brand-new doors.
  4. How do I measure for a brand-new bifold door frame?Procedure the width and height of the door frame, taking into account any irregularities or unevenness in the walls. It is advised to take multiple measurements to guarantee precision.
  5. How do I change the tension on the bifold doors?Changing the stress on bifold doors can be done by tightening or loosening up the screws on the top of the door frame. It is important to ensure the doors are effectively well balanced and aligned to avoid damage to the track system or the doors.
